Detailed Description

WeatherFile derives from ModelObject and is an interface to the OpenStudio IDD object named "OS:WeatherFile".

WeatherFile is a unique object which references an EPW format weather file to use for EnergyPlus simulation. EnergyPlus requires the weather file for simulation be named in.epw and located in the same directory as the input IDF file. The WeatherFile object provides a mechanism for an OpenStudio Model to reference a weather file in a more permanent way. The RunManager is able to locate the actual weather file needed and place it in the EnergyPlus run directory at simulation time. WeatherFile does not have a public constructor because it is a unique ModelObject. To get the WeatherFile object for a Model or create one if it does not yet exist use model.getUniqueObject<WeatherFile>(). To get the WeatherFile object for a Model but not create one if it does not yet exist use model.getOptionalUniqueObject<WeatherFile>().
